King’s College Hospital NHS Foundation Trust is one of the UK’s largest and busiest teaching Trusts with a turnover of c£1 billion, 1.5 million patient contacts a year and more than 13,500 staff based across 5 main sites in South East London. The Trust provides a full range of local hospital services across its different sites, and specialist services from King’s College Hospital (KCH) sites at Denmark Hill in Camberwell and at the Princess Royal University Hospital (PRUH) site in the London Borough of Bromley.

King’s College Hospital’s Occupational Health and Well-being department is dedicated to providing a high quality, efficient and supportive service to the staff of King’s and other associated organisations across several sites in South East London.

As a dynamic and progressive SEQOHS accredited department we have a strong, multidisciplinary team of nurses, physicians and therapists within a busy, fast paced environment.

Band 5 Practice Nurses are the front line of our service, running our immunisation clinics, and screening new entrants to the Trust, and the associated organisations we support.
